The Board of Certification/Accreditation (BOC) announced the addition of a new certification for the durable medical equipment specialist.

The new certification leverages BOC’s expertise in the individual certification field with their knowledge of the durable medical equipment (DME) industry, gained through more than 20 years experience with DMEPOS accreditation. The certified DME exam will be offered business days and some Saturdays at testing locations nationwide, and candidates will receive their results instantly, according to a press release.

The certified DME specialist (CDME) will provide equipment delivery and set up, basic repairs and troubleshooting, and patient education.

“In introducing the DME specialist certification we bridge our two major programs, certification and accreditation,” Claudia Zacharias, MBA, CAE, president and chief executive officer of BOC, stated in the release. “The addition of the CDME is another example of how BOC fulfills our promise to the allied health community to ensure safe practice environments.”
